Mesothelioma Claim

A mesothelioma suit is an opportunity to receive compensation for asbestos-related damage. Victims and their families are eligible for financial compensation via a jury verdict, a bargained settlement, a VA claim or an asbestos trust fund award.

Compensation can cover cancer treatment and offer financial aid. It also assists families with other expenses related to this disease.

Workers are entitled to compensation

Workers' compensation insurance is a form of insurance that provides monetary benefits to those who are injured at work. This type of benefit can pay for medical expenses and lost wages. However, it doesn't typically cover the payment for pain and suffering or punitive damages. Additionally, certain states limit the time that a person is able to apply for workers' compensation.

Lawyers who specialize in mesothelioma are able to assist patients and their families file for benefits. They can also assist patients understand the different types compensation they are eligible for. These include personal injury lawsuits asbestos trust funds, personal injury lawsuits, and workers' compensation.

The majority of mesothelioma patients can make a personal injury claim against the asbestos companies that exposed them to mesothelioma. The lawsuits are typically classified into two categories: economic and noneconomic damages. The financial awards for the first category are based on the cost of treatment, the loss of income, and expenses documented related to a mesothelioma-related diagnosis. Noneconomic damages, on the other hand are granted to compensate a person for their emotional and physical stress and loss of enjoyment of life, and other losses that are intangible.

Personal injury lawsuits

Patients suffering from mesothelioma are able to sue the companies who exposed them to asbestos. These lawsuits are intended to hold these corporations accountable for their actions. They also offer compensation for medical expenses, lost income and other losses. Mesothelioma patients could file an action for personal injury when they are still alive. in certain states, the lawsuit may be pursued by their estate representatives after death.

During the process of suing for mesothelioma, victims will be able to work with lawyers who have experience in asbestos exposure and can assist in obtaining evidence from former employers. The victim will need to gather documentation including the history of their work, medical records, and testimonials from coworkers and family members. This information will be used to determine the amount of an claim.

After a mesothelioma lawsuit is filed, a defendant will have a limited time to respond. The time frame for responding to a mesothelioma claim is different from state to. The defendant can either settle out of the court with the plaintiff or refute the allegations, which would begin the trial process.

If the defendant fails to reach a settlement with the plaintiff the defendant will be required to pay a certain amount to the victim. This is referred to as an award of compensation. The money is used to pay for medical expenses, funeral costs and loss of income. Mesothelioma compensation awards also include non-economic damages such as pain and suffering, as well as loss of consortium.

Although there have been class action lawsuits in the past, most mesothelioma claims are handled as individual lawsuits. Certain cases can be combined into a multidistrict lawsuit (MDL) to improve efficiency.

Disability benefits

Mesothelioma compensation can help patients and their families pay for living expenses such as household bills loss of wages, medical care and other expenses that are associated with the disease. It can also provide financial security in the event of the patient's death. The three major types of mesothelioma settlements are trust funds, lawsuits and settlements. A reliable mesothelioma lawyer firm to file a claim can help victims receive the maximum amount of compensation in a reasonable amount of time.

If a mesothelioma sufferer has the right to be eligible for SSDI, they will have to provide medical documentation to prove their condition. The most reliable evidence is the results of a pathology test which identifies cancer cells from a biopsy. Other documents that can prove mesothelioma include hospital records, doctor notes, and statements from family.

Before awarding disability benefits before granting disability benefits, the SSA will also assess the prognosis of the patient and evaluate their capacity to work. If the mesothelioma patient is not able to work and is unable to work, they are entitled to monthly disability checks. These benefits are based on the average lifetime earnings they have paid into Social Security. Mesothelioma patients may also qualify for state-based disability benefits and supplemental assistance that is not provided by Social Security.
